Military exposure

Many veterans served in the military during a period where asbestos was extensively used. The toxic substance was incorporated into military bases as well as vehicles, aircrafts and ships. Sadly, these companies were aware about the health hazards of their products but hid this information from the military to increase profits. These women and men were unaware of the dangers until they began to develop asbestos-related diseases like mesothelioma, which was discovered decades later.

The military relied on Asbestos because it was durable and fire-resistant. It was used to create insulation in the manufacture of vehicles and ships and even in clothing. Asbestos was discovered in numerous military establishments, including Army bases, Navy yards and Coast Guard ships. All branches of the military are vulnerable to asbestos-related diseases, but veterans from the Army are more likely to suffer from asbestos-related illnesses.

The United States Army relied on asbestos-based products for a large portion of its history. Soldiers who worked in engines or boiler rooms were exposed to asbestos. In addition the Air Force also utilized numerous asbestos-based products. The risk of exposure also extended to pilots, mechanics and other personnel working in the cockpit.

Since mesothelioma symptoms usually don't manifest until 20-50 years after exposure, countless veterans have been diagnosed with the disease. Veterans Affairs might be able to provide benefits to those men and women. These benefits can be used to cover the costs of treatment for mesothelioma, among other ailments.

A VA disability claim could help a veteran gain access to the most reputable mesothelioma specialists in the world. It also provides the cost of living and other expenses associated with mesothelioma. However it is important to note that a VA claim is not an alternative to an individual injury lawsuit against the asbestos-related companies that caused the exposure.

Bankruptcy

Companies that exposed victims to asbestos knowingly and recklessly could be held accountable in lawsuits. Some of these companies declared bankruptcy to stay out of liability for their actions. If a company declares bankruptcy, any the pending lawsuits are stopped. The victims can still make trust fund claims against the bankrupt business. These funds are created through the bankruptcy process to compensate mesothelioma patients.

Filing a lawsuit

A mesothelioma case is a means for those who have suffered of asbestos exposure to hold companies responsible. Asbestos lawsuits are filed to obtain compensation for victims and could result in substantial settlements. Financial compensation can assist victims with mesothelioma treatments and other costs. Victims and their families are suing companies for their actions. Many asbestos-related companies knew asbestos was dangerous, but did not inform workers, resulting in asbestos exposure. Asbestos fibers are inhaled or eaten and may cause mesothelioma and lung cancer.

There are two kinds of mesothelioma lawsuits: personal injury andwrongful death. The statute of limitations for personal injury mesothelioma lawsuits is a period of time that can last for a few years following a diagnosis, whereas the statute of limitations for wrongful death mesothelioma lawsuits begins when a loved one dies of mesothelioma or an asbestos-related disease.

The compensation for mesothelioma cases could include damages for medical expenses, lost income, and pain and suffering. Compensation may differ based on the severity and type of symptoms, aswell depending on the location the location where the victim was employed.
